Help Line VolunteersEvery year thousands of adults and adolescents contact the Community Help Service (CHS) in need of our help. The HELP LINE provides an anonymous and confidential, crisis, support and information service to the English-Speaking community. We are looking for volunteers who are: - Good listeners No previous experience necessary. Following the interview process, comprehensive training and professional supervision are provided.
